
Mavs and Kats meet Wednesday in Arlington

The game will be broadcast on KSAM 101.7 FM.
The Mavericks bring a 9-5 season record into the contest while Sam Houston stands 6-9 for the year.
UTA brings a five-game winning streak into the contest after an 85-55 victory Saturday over Nicholls State. The five consecutive victories represent the program's longest since a five-game run during the 2009-10 season.
Sam Houston fell to 2012 Southland Conference West Division favorite UTSA 62-60 on a Roadrunner basket with 1.9 seconds to play.
Konner Tucker leads Sam Houston with 11.7 points per game. Steven Werner adds 10.4 points and 5.6 rebounds per contest.
Marcus James, the only returning letterman in the Kat starting lineup, contributes 9.2 points and leads the squad with 7.1 rebounds per game.
The Mavericks are 6-1 at home this season, and 49-14 since the start of the 2007-08 season. The Mavericks only have one game left at Texas Hall after facing Sam Houston, with Stephen F. Austin visiting on Feb. 21. The Mavericks make their debut at the College Park Center on Feb. 1 against Southland rival UTSA.
LaMarcus Reed leads the Mavericks in scoring at 14.2 points per game and has scored in double figures 12 times, while Bo Ingram has averaged over 14.2 points a contest over the last six.
UTA and Sam Houston are meeting for the 56th time with the Bearkats holding a 34-21 all-time edge and a 14-13 record in games played in Arlington.
Sam Houston has won the last two meetings, both coming last season. UTA last beat Sam Houston in Arlington, 95-85, on Feb. 28, 2009.
